How Do I Install OCR Software on My Computer?

Irene Olsen

If you need to convert scanned documents or images into editable text, OCR (Optical Character Recognition) software is what you need. This software recognizes the text in the image and converts it into a format that can be edited. In this article, we will go through the steps of installing OCR software on your computer.

Step 1: Choose an OCR Software

The first step is to choose an OCR software that suits your needs. There are many free and paid options available online. Some popular choices include Adobe Acrobat, ABBYY FineReader, and Tesseract OCR.

Step 2: Download the Software

Once you have chosen the software you want to use, you need to download it from its official website. Most OCR software providers offer a trial version for users to try before making a purchase.

For Example:

  • If you choose Adobe Acrobat, go to their website and click on “Download” or “Try Now.”
  • If you choose Tesseract OCR, go to their GitHub repository and download the latest version.

Step 3: Install the Software

After downloading the software, open the executable file and follow the installation wizard. Make sure to read all prompts carefully before clicking “Next” or “Install.”

Note:

Some OCR software may require additional components such as language packs or third-party libraries. These components may be included in the installation package or need to be downloaded separately.

Step 4: Configure Settings (Optional)

Depending on your needs, you may want to configure some settings in your OCR software. For example, you may want to select a specific language for recognition or adjust image quality settings.

Note:

The configuration process varies depending on the OCR software you are using. Consult the software’s documentation or online resources for more information.

Step 5: Start Using the Software

After installation and configuration (if necessary), you can start using your OCR software. Simply open the program, select the image or document you want to convert, and follow the prompts to initiate recognition.

Note:

Some OCR software may have a plugin that integrates with other programs such as Microsoft Word or Adobe Photoshop. Check if your software has such a plugin to make the process even easier.
